Position Summary: The Freedom of Information Act (FOIA)/Records Specialist provides Federal records management, FOIA/Privacy Act documentation support, FACA documentation support, information collection support, records workflow support, and compliance-driven documentation support for a Federal correspondence and content management program. This role supports records identification, records requirements, documentation of workflows, records inventories, content organization, and controlled correspondence support. This role supports FOIA/Privacy Act and FACA-related records and documentation activities but does not serve as a Government FOIA decision-maker.
